
Fruit puree jelly
Description
The recipe won't take much time. You can use any fruit puree; homemade is best, but store-bought works fine too. Adjust the sugar to your taste, but keep in mind that gelatin reduces sweetness, so the final result will be less sweet. If desired, pour the mixture into ramekins and serve the jelly in them. Store the jelly in the refrigerator and serve chilled.
Instructions
- 1
Step 1

Prepare all the necessary ingredients for making jelly from fruit puree.
- 2
Step 2

Transfer the puree to a deep bowl, add sugar and fast-acting gelatin. Mix everything and let it stand for 5 minutes.
- 3
Step 3

Heat the mixture until the sugar and gelatin dissolve. The mixture should become smooth. This can be done over low heat or in the microwave, heating in 20-second intervals.
- 4
Step 4

Cool the mixture to room temperature and beat with a mixer until light and fluffy.
- 5
Step 5

Grease any mold with vegetable oil and transfer the mixture into it. Refrigerate for 2-3 hours until set. Then cut the jelly into pieces, transfer to a serving dish, and serve.
